The number of people that arrived in Spain illegally by land through the autonomous cities of Ceuta and Melilla fluctuated over the period of time under consideration, peaking in 2018 at 6,800. The number of irregular migrants that arrived in Spain by land via Ceuta and Melilla was estimated to be approximately 2,289 in 2022.
